Owing to the unequivelent economic strength of the two parties to an international consumer contract, the consumer protection policy has guided many countries' legislation on their international private law. According to practical examples of several countries and international conventions, the consumer protection policy has been implemented in the regulation on jurisdiction and choice of law of international consumer contracts, which indicates the speciality and tendency of legislation on international consumer contract. E-commerce matters have been newly regulated by many countries, and the regulation on international electronic consumer contracts holds the policy of consumer protection as well. And the study above provides reference to Chinese legislation. |
